Market Shift: Reddit’s Strategic Acquisition Plans
Reddit’s recent fourth-quarter earnings call unveiled the company’s proactive strategy to pursue strategic acquisitions within the advertising technology sector. CFO Andrew Vollero articulated Reddit’s ambition to seek out organizations that can either enhance the platform’s existing capabilities or expand its audience reach. This pursuit is not merely opportunistic; it reflects a carefully crafted approach to bolster Reddit’s competitive edge in an increasingly crowded market.
According to a report by eMarketer, the global digital advertising market is projected to reach $600 billion by 2024. This growth presents a significant opportunity for Reddit, particularly as it aims to capture a larger share of the advertising revenue pie. Vollero’s statement about seeking “capabilities, technologies, and companies” suggests that Reddit is not just looking for immediate gains, but rather for sustainable growth through strategic integrations.
The company has a track record of effective acquisitions, having previously integrated technologies that have significantly enhanced its advertising capabilities. For instance, the acquisition of Memorable AI in August 2024 was aimed at improving ad targeting and user engagement, showcasing Reddit’s commitment to leveraging external expertise to enhance its platform.
Furthermore, a report from Gartner highlights that organizations that effectively integrate acquired technologies can achieve a competitive advantage in their respective markets. This aligns with Reddit’s strategy of expediting its time to market by leveraging proven products, ultimately positioning itself to capitalize on emerging trends in the advertising space.
Second-Order Effects
While the immediate implications of Reddit’s acquisition strategy are clear, the second-order effects are where the true impact may lie. As Reddit integrates new technologies and capabilities, several potential shifts could occur in the digital advertising landscape.
Increased Competition
As Reddit enhances its advertising capabilities, it is poised to become a more formidable competitor against established players like Google and Facebook. This could lead to increased competition for ad dollars, forcing other platforms to innovate and improve their offerings to maintain market share. As the advertising landscape evolves, we may witness a reallocation of budgets as advertisers seek more effective and integrated solutions.
Shifts in User Engagement
The integration of advanced technologies could also lead to shifts in user engagement on Reddit. Enhanced targeting capabilities and personalized advertising experiences may result in higher engagement rates, attracting more advertisers to the platform. However, this could also raise concerns regarding user privacy and data utilization, prompting a need for transparent practices to maintain user trust.
